Professor Adekunle Adekile

Dr. Adekile graduated from the University of Ibadan, Nigeria, and completed his post-doctoral fellowship in Pediatric Hematology at Howard University Hospital in Washington, DC, USA. He was a Fogarty International Fellow in Molecular Genetics at the Medical College of Georgia in Augusta, GA, USA, from 1990 to 1993. Between 1993 and 2024, he was a Professor at Kuwait University. He is an Adjunct Professor of Pediatrics at Emory University in Atlanta, GA, and at the University of Abuja, Nigeria. He was the Founding Chairman of the Nigerian Sickle Cell Disease Network and the Sickle Cell Support Society of Nigeria. Dr. Adekile specializes in the clinical, hematological, and molecular aspects of sickle cell disease (SCD) in patients with a high HbF phenotype. He was a consultant to WHO/AFRO on the guidance framework for managing SCD in Africa. Currently, he is the Editor-in-Chief of Hemoglobin.
